Family Event: Macy’s Pink Pig

Taking place outside Macy’s at Buckhead’s Lenox Square Mall, the Atlanta holiday tradition is back for more holiday fun, excitement and memories. National retail giant Macy’s brings its world-famous Pink Pig ride back to Atlanta to celebrate the 2010 holiday season in style. The Pink Pig ride originated at the downtown Rich’s department store, but when that establishment closed its doors, it moved to its current home at Lenox Square, housed underneath the Pink Pig tent. Since debuting in 1953, grandparents, parents and children have all had the pleasure of sharing in the numerous family memories that are instantly created after just one ride on this iconic Atlanta treasure. For many Atlantans, once the Pink Pig arrives you know the holiday season is officially here. Today families board the train ride and are whisked away through the life-sized storybook land called A Pig’s Tale, which combines the wonderful ride with a lovely story that will resonate with adults and children alike.
